[TWIG][UI] Settings: removed unnecessary pages, responsive CSS work

This commit is contained in:
rainydaysavings
2020-06-28 23:50:05 +01:00
committed by Hugo Sales
parent 1498c44e74
commit 82d50cc962
10 changed files with 97 additions and 138 deletions

View File

@@ -46,12 +46,11 @@ abstract class Main
$r->connect('doc_' . $s, 'doc/' . $s, TemplateController::class, [], ['defaults' => ['template' => 'faq/' . $s . '.html.twig']]);
}
// Settings pages
foreach (['profile', 'avatar'] as $s) {
$r->connect('settings_' . $s, 'settings/' . $s, C\UserAdminPanel::class);
}
foreach (['email', 'pass', 'bak'] as $s) {
$r->connect('account_' . $s, 'settings/account/' . $s, C\UserAdminPanel::class);
}
$r->connect('account_settings', 'settings/account', C\UserAdminPanel::class);
}
}